CHS 2010 - Survey of Chicana/o Literature



Credits: 3

Prerequisite(s): CHS 1000 or ENG 1010 or permission of the instructor

Prerequisite(s) or Corequisite(s): ENG 1020 or permission of instructor

Description: This course is a review of major literary genres associated with Chicana/o and Latina/o creative expression from the 1800s to the present, including poetry, drama, and the novel. Students in this course examine themes related to the Chicana/o and Latina/o experience such as racism, colonialism, sexism, and other structural forms of oppression, and the social justice efforts to combat these systems of oppression.

Note: Credit will be granted for only one prefix: CHS or ENG.

General Studies: Arts and Humanities

Guaranteed Transfer: GT-AH2

University Requirement(s): Ethnic Studies & Social Justice

Cross Listed Course(s): ENG 2410
